logo

Output d85a66728c28f388a6499fd1841a1d9164b784c68da6bc43d2238f8d10f46c82: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76fc479a0df0b8802e5eee144520135929abd9d8 OP_EQUAL
address
3CY9st1HTnf9ZDKTidxdzamA7HTHCdkcLD
transaction
d85a66728c28f388a6499fd1841a1d9164b784c68da6bc43d2238f8d10f46c82